Sayenko Kharenko advises Ukreximbank on the first successful debt restructuring in line with the IMF’s Extended Fund Facility

Sayenko Kharenko acted as legal advisor to Joint Stock Company The State Export-Import Bank of Ukraine (Ukreximbank) on restructuring of its Eurobond issues due 2015, 2016 and 2018. This was the first debt restructuring carried out in line with the requirements of the IMF’s Extended Fund Facility.

The Eurobonds subject to restructuring included two senior notes issues due 2015 and 2018 and a subordinated notes issue due 2016. The restructuring covered extension of the maturity of each of the notes issues by seven years, increasing the coupon and modifying the repayment schedule from bullet to amortizing repayment.
